The UK was leading on tackling climate change – so why is the Government now failing to act?
Four years ago this week I felt immensely proud that the UK was leading the way in tackling climate change after the UK Parliament passed the Climate Change Act. Yet as world leaders gather in Doha for the UN Climate Change talks, it’s hard not to feel pessimistic.
